Benefits of Connecting Square to QuickBooks
1. Simplified Bookkeeping:
When you connect Square to QuickBooks, all transactions from your Square account are automatically synced into QuickBooks, eliminating the need to manually enter each transaction. This not only saves time but also reduces errors that can occur when entering data by hand. 2. Improved Accuracy:
By syncing transactions in real-time, you can ensure that your financial records are accurate and up-to-date. No longer will you have to worry about missing or lost sales, as all transactions from Square are reflected accurately in QuickBooks. 3. Enhanced Reporting Capabilities:
QuickBooks provides a range of reporting tools that allow you to easily track key performance indicators (KPIs) such as revenue, expenses, and profit margins. When connected to Square, these reports become even more powerful, providing valuable insights into your business’s financial health. 4. Streamlined Inventory Management:
If you have an online store or a brick-and-mortar location with inventory, connecting Square to QuickBooks allows you to track inventory levels and manage stock movements accurately. This ensures that you’re always aware of what products are on hand, reducing waste and minimizing overstocking. 5. Improved Compliance:
By having all your financial data in one place, you can ensure compliance with tax laws and regulations. QuickBooks provides a range of tools and resources to help you navigate complex tax requirements, while Square ensures that you’re always up-to-date on sales tax reporting.
Connecting Square to QuickBooks: A Step-by-Step Guide
1. Log In to Your Square Account:
Start by logging in to your Square account online or through the mobile app. Ensure you have access to your login credentials and that your business is set up correctly. 2. Go to the Settings Page:
Navigate to the settings page within your Square account, where you’ll find an option to connect to QuickBooks. 3. Choose Your Integration Method:
Square offers two integration methods: manual import and automated syncing. Manual import allows you to upload transactions from Square into QuickBooks manually, while automated syncing syncs transactions automatically in the background. 4. Set Up Your QuickBooks Account:
If you haven’t already set up your QuickBooks account, now is the time. Create a new company file or log in to an existing one. Ensure that your business setup matches your Square settings for accurate imports. 5. Connect Square to QuickBooks:
Once you’ve selected your integration method and set up your QuickBooks account, follow the prompts to connect your accounts. This may involve granting permission to QuickBooks to access your Square data or verifying the connection settings. 6. Verify Your Connection:
After connecting your accounts, verify that transactions are syncing correctly by checking your QuickBooks account for new imports.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
1. Transactions Not Syncing:
If transactions aren’t syncing as expected, check the following: * Ensure both accounts are set up correctly. * Verify that the integration method is correct (manual import vs automated syncing). * Check for any errors or issues with your Square account. 2. Error Messages:
If you encounter error messages during setup, refer to the Square and QuickBooks support resources: * Review the QuickBooks user guide for troubleshooting tips. * Contact Square support for assistance with connection issues. 3. Syncing Issues After Setup:
If syncing issues persist after connecting your accounts, try restarting both apps or re-verifying the connection settings.
